Recessed light installation is a fantastic way to enhance the ambiance of your indoor spaces while saving valuable floor space. This lighting option, often referred to as 'can lighting' or 'downlights,' is designed to be flush with the ceiling, providing a clean and unobtrusive look. Whether you're looking to brighten up a kitchen, living room, or hallway, recessed lights can be an excellent choice for both general and accent lighting.
Here are some key benefits of recessed light installation:
- Space-Saving: Since they are installed into the ceiling, recessed lights do not take up any floor or table space.
- Versatile Design: Available in various sizes and styles, they can complement any decor.
- Adjustable Lighting: Many recessed fixtures come with adjustable features, allowing you to direct light where it's needed most.
- Energy Efficiency: LED recessed lights consume less energy compared to traditional bulbs, saving you money on electricity bills.
To ensure a successful recessed light installation, consider factors such as the spacing between lights, the type of bulbs, and the overall layout of your room. It's essential to choose the right size and wattage to achieve the desired brightness without overwhelming the space.
